Firstly, the raw hematite ores are evenly sent to a jaw crusher through a vibrating feeder for coarse crushing, then are sent to a cone crusher for fine crushing. Next, the ore is screened by a vibrating screen. Those whose particle size meet the requirements would be sent for grinding, while the others would return the cone c…

WhatsApp: +86 182217550738.1.7.4 Chromium from Chrome Slag. Gravity separation has been applied to process chrome slag by steel researchers in India. Heavy media separation (Choudhury et al., 1996) and crushing and jigging (Khan et al., 2001) are the principal techniques used.The slag is subjected to 2-stage crushing to reduce the size to −10 mm and then screened into −10 +1 mm and −1 mm fractions.

WhatsApp: +86 18221755073Since hematite and dolomite particles have different densities, 5.25 and 2.87 g/cm 3, respectively, and that method requires less energy, this paper aims to concentrate hematite from a zinc mining tailing composed of 3% SiO 2, 7% Fe 2 O 3, and 90% CaMg(CO 3) 2 through gravity separation using shaking table.
